ChatGPT answers from its trained knowledge by default, and only triggers ChatGPT Search when the model decides a live web lookup is needed. The two surfaces produce different answers and cite different sources. Every prompt is tracked across both, with split visibility scores for each.
Knowing whether your brand is missing from the trained model, the live web answer, or both is the first step in deciding where to act.

ChatGPT generates answers from a combination of its trained knowledge (the data the model was trained on) and ChatGPT Search (live web retrieval, triggered when the model decides a lookup is needed). Brand mentions come from how prominently a brand appears in those sources, including editorial coverage, official pages, UGC platforms like Reddit and Quora, and review aggregators. The model weighs authority, recency, and consensus across sources when deciding what to surface.

ChatGPT collapses part of the search journey into a single conversational answer, which compresses the traditional click curve in categories where AI answers are good enough. Brands that win the ChatGPT citation slot capture impressions and brand recall that used to be split across the top 10 Google results. Brands that do not start appearing in the citation sources ChatGPT pulls from lose visibility even when their domain ranks well in Google.
